I don't think it makes a difference at all.. as long as you give yourself plenty of time to write a kick-ass cover letter. From the guy that ran recruiting for the firm where I was an SA, "cover letters are often generic and just a recap of the resume. If you can give me information why you are genuinely interested in our position, I will value that just as much as your resume"

What I took away from this - seem genuine and interested. I know that most BB's just look at resume's, but smaller shops take time to read every aspect of the application, so make sure effort is put into everything. By this.. if it takes you 20 min to write a solid and personalized CL, maybe give yourself 30 min to work on the application before the deadline. Otherwise, just prepare accordingly.

Most deadlines are set while employees aren't in the office. The only difference that makes is 11:59 vs 12:01 (for example). Don't leave it to chance or a shitty internet connection.
